almer ibarra🛠️ 1 tool 🙏 1 karmaJan 11, 2026@EchotherEchother is exactly what I was looking for to speed up our meetings. While other tools trap you in $X/month subscriptions for basic transcription, echother does something different, it connects your meeting discussions to your actual codebase and generates Jira tickets with real context. The repo-aware ticket generation cut our sprint refinement time in half because we stopped re-explaining everything. Instead of vague tickets that need clarification later, we get tickets with file references, implementation patterns, and technical context pulled directly from our code. It's saved us 10+ hours per week that used to disappear into coordination overhead. No corporate fluff, just meetings that actually turn into actionable work. -
